Summary

The Folke H. Peterson Foundation Grant aims to prevent cruelty to animals and enhance their welfare. It provides funding for organizations focused on animal protection, medical assistance, and food supplies, ensuring these efforts directly benefit animals. Eligible applicants must be 501(c)(3) tax-exempt organizations within the United States. Notably, the foundation will not support any organization involved in euthanizing healthy animals, reinforcing its commitment to animal welfare.

Overview

About the Foundation The mission of the Folke H. Peterson Foundation is to prevent cruelty to animals and to benefit and improve the quality of life for animals. Funding Priorities: Funds may be distributed directly for organizations to protect animals, for medical assistance, and for food for animals so long as such prevents cruelty to animals and benefits animals. Types of Support: Program  Project  General Operating Emergency Funding

Eligibility

You can learn more about this opportunity by visiting the funder's website. Geographic Focus:

United States Eligibility Requirements:
The Trustees will consider qualified applications received from organizations that are exempt from taxation under the Internal Revenue Code Section 501 (c)(3).

Ineligibility

Restrictions: No funds shall be paid to any organization which euthanizes healthy animals.
